Frog Cellsat Limited (NSE:FROG)
India flag India · Delayed Price · Currency is INR
132.40
+3.70 (2.87%)
Feb 19, 2026, 3:24 PM IST

Frog Cellsat Ratios and Metrics

Millions INR.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 2021
Period Ending
Feb '26 Mar '25 Mar '24 Mar '23 Mar '22 Mar '21
1,9993,3572,5322,181--
Market Cap Growth
-69.38%32.58%16.11%---
Enterprise Value
2,1303,2502,5462,175--
Last Close Price
128.70217.50164.70141.85--
PE Ratio
8.4614.2616.3214.45--
PS Ratio
0.911.531.611.61--
PB Ratio
1.252.101.901.87--
P/TBV Ratio
1.252.101.911.88--
P/OCF Ratio
--35.4530.24--
EV/Sales Ratio
0.971.481.611.61--
EV/EBITDA Ratio
5.708.6912.568.85--
EV/EBIT Ratio
6.409.7714.719.45--
Debt / Equity Ratio
0.130.130.04-0.090.10
Debt / EBITDA Ratio
0.540.540.23-0.280.50
Debt / FCF Ratio
----9.410.89
Net Debt / Equity Ratio
0.080.080.02-0.17-0.09-0.21
Net Debt / EBITDA Ratio
0.350.350.16-0.82-0.30-1.08
Net Debt / FCF Ratio
-1.00-1.00-0.110.77-10.02-1.91
Asset Turnover
1.161.161.071.151.401.34
Inventory Turnover
4.314.313.532.823.954.58
Quick Ratio
1.621.621.652.641.371.64
Current Ratio
2.242.243.154.122.542.32
Return on Equity (ROE)
16.07%16.07%12.43%16.27%23.02%24.35%
Return on Assets (ROA)
11.00%11.00%7.32%12.27%13.46%6.71%
Return on Invested Capital (ROIC)
15.77%15.41%11.27%21.36%26.41%15.47%
Return on Capital Employed (ROCE)
20.50%20.50%12.80%19.50%28.20%14.80%
Earnings Yield
11.78%7.02%6.13%6.92%--
FCF Yield
-6.56%-3.91%-11.55%-12.06%--
Payout Ratio
----33.91%-
Buyback Yield / Dilution
-0.53%-0.53%-16.33%-17.09%--
Total Shareholder Return
-0.53%-0.53%-16.33%-17.09%--
Updated Mar 31,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.